Gifu vs Asheville, North Carolina Climate & Distance Between

Usa flag
  • The distance between Gifu, Japan and Asheville, North Carolina, Usa is approximately 11,148 km or 6,927 mi.
  • To reach Gifu in this distance one would set out from Asheville, North Carolina bearing 328.3° or NNW and follow the great circles arc to approach Gifu bearing 211.6° or SSW .
  • Both have a humid subtropical climate (Cfa).
  • Gifu is in or near the warm temperate moist forest biome whereas Asheville, North Carolina is in or near the cool temperate moist forest biome.
  • The mean annual temperature is 2.2 °C (4°F) warmer.
  • Average monthly temperatures vary by 3 °C (5.4°F) more in Gifu. The continentality subtype is subcontinental as opposed to semicontinental.
  • Total annual precipitation averages 725.1 mm (28.5 in) more which is equivalent to 725.1 l/m² (17.8 US gal/ft²) or 7,251,000 l/ha (775,180 US gal/ac) more. About 1 3/5 as much.
  • The altitude of the sun at midday is overall 0° higher in Gifu than in Asheville, North Carolina.
  • Relative humidity levels are 15.4% higher.
  • The mean dew point temperature is 5.7°C (10.2°F) higher.
